Do you want the good news first, or would you prefer the bad?..........

Well, I guess we can start off with being hungry/starving at 7days post-op. I'm sure you don't want to hear this, but this is your mind playing tricks on you. We call it Head Hunger. The hormone that is produced in your stomach that triggers hunger simply is not there right now. It might return a few months down the road, but not for a while yet.

The "bad" thing you did, chewing food to get the flavor then spitting it out. It's pretty common among early sleeves. I would say over 1/2 of us have done it. Just be very careful with this type of habit, I'd hate to see it turn into an eating disorder.

Now the good news, you are surrounded with people just like you, chances are there is nothing you will experience or will do, that most of us haven't either done or at least seriously contemplated.

We are a bunch of food addicts, and we are taking this journey together. Learning about ourselves, & finding out, we really aren't alone in our trials. And neither are you.
